Technological Advancements

The Space Race accelerated the development of rockets, spacecraft, and other technologies. The Soviets initially dominated with the early successes of Sputnik and Gagarin’s historic orbit around Earth. However, the United States responded with the establishment of NASA and the Mercury, Gemini, and Apollo programs.

These programs led to significant advancements in rocket propulsion, spacecraft design, and navigation systems, culminating in the historic Apollo 11 mission that landed humans on the Moon in 1969.

Impact on Society and Culture

The Space Race had a profound impact on society and culture. It ignited public interest in science, technology, and space exploration, inspiring a generation of scientists and engineers. The race also influenced popular culture, with space-themed movies, TV shows, and music becoming prevalent.

Internationally, it became a symbol of national pride and a measure of technological prowess, shaping diplomatic relations and global politics.

Challenges and Triumphs

The Space Race was not without its challenges. Both the United States and the Soviet Union faced numerous setbacks, including failed launches, spacecraft malfunctions, and the tragic loss of astronauts. However, these challenges only fueled their determination, leading to groundbreaking triumphs.

The first moon landing, achieved by the Apollo 11 crew, remains one of humanity’s greatest scientific achievements.

The legacy of the Space Race continues to shape space exploration and scientific research. It fostered international cooperation, leading to the establishment of the International Space Station. The technologies developed during the race have paved the way for satellite communications, weather forecasting, and GPS navigation systems.

Moreover, the spirit of competition and innovation continues to inspire future generations of scientists and engineers to push the boundaries of human knowledge.
